Abstract

A team of students of the Community Service Program, in collaboration with its lecturers, carried out Community Service in Cipicung Village, Jatigede District, Sumedang Regency, with the theme of journalistic content management and website development training for tourist areas. This Community Service aims to improve the ability of website managers to promote Jatigede's tourism potential more effectively, equip managers with journalistic content creation skills to have attractive information and encourage the community to participate and become the main actors in sustainably promoting Jatigede tourist destinations. The implementation method was carried out through lectures, discussions, practices and simulations. These collaborative community service activities produced four articles contents and four videos contents uploaded to the Jatigede District website and YouTube with the theme of potential, superior products, the benefits of mango “gedong gincu”, Small and Medium Enterprise (SME) products and the tourism potential of Al-Kamil Mosque. In addition, the training results also showed an increase in the knowledge and ability of village and sub-district website managers in Jatigede. This activity also received a positive and sustainable response as a fostered area.

Abstract

Pandemi Covid-19 dan kebijakan pembatasan sosial menyebabkan industri musik, khususnya konser luring, mengalami stagnasi sehingga promotor dan musisi terdorong mencari bentuk penyelenggaraan baru berbasis teknologi digital. Penelitian ini bertujuan menganalisis konser virtual sebagai dinamika industri musik Indonesia sekaligus melihat bagaimana praktik tersebut merekonstruksi relasi komunikasi antara musisi dan audiens, dengan studi kasus Wave Djava Virtual Concert yang disiarkan melalui kanal YouTube Hellprint Official. Penelitian menggunakan pendekatan kualitatif dengan desain studi kasus. Data dikumpulkan melalui wawancara mendalam dengan informan yang dipilih secara purposif, observasi terhadap tayangan konser virtual di YouTube (termasuk karakteristik konten, jumlah penonton, dan interaksi di kolom komentar), serta studi literatur sebagai landasan konseptual. Analisis data dilakukan secara induktif dengan model Miles dan Huberman melalui reduksi, penyajian, dan penarikan kesimpulan-verifikasi. Hasil penelitian menunjukkan bahwa konser virtual membentuk segmen penonton baru dan memperlihatkan adaptasi musisi serta promotor terhadap teknologi digital, sehingga memperluas jangkauan audiens dan menjaga keberlanjutan aktivitas industri musik di masa krisis. Konser virtual juga merepresentasikan konvergensi media, di mana unsur komunikasi tetap berlangsung namun bergeser ke medium digital sehingga interaksi menjadi tidak langsung dan berpotensi tertunda. Selain itu, praktik ini menguatkan hubungan komunikasi parasosial melalui kedekatan emosional yang dibangun lewat fitur platform dan pola konsumsi daring, serta mendorong terbentuknya kebiasaan baru dalam menikmati pertunjukan musik.

Abstract

This article discusses how media convergence, as a new era of media in welcoming the industrial revolution, is not working properly. The purpose of this study is to explain how the media today still often create content with profit priority. By using Vincent Mosco's political economy theory and case studies on local media with national networks, the author tries to unravel how the media performs its functions. As a result, even though the media has developed more advanced with the era of digital media, the media is still often used for political interests or other interests through the titles or news content they make. To anticipate this, the general public should equip themselves with the capabilities of media literacy and digital literacy, so that they  cannot choose a media that is suitable for consumption in the era of industrial revolution 4.0 where the media has developed into digital domain.
